本文聚焦龙腾火龙传奇手游,拆解自动打怪、技能释放、回血回蓝、拾取过滤等核心脚本功能,提供适配手游操作逻辑的编写框架与实操代码,兼顾新手入门与实操落地。
一、龙腾火龙手游脚本核心功能定位
龙腾火龙手游延续传奇经典玩法,新增火龙专属地图与怪物机制,脚本需适配手游触屏操作逻辑与地图特性。核心满足五大需求:精准锁定火龙系怪物、自动释放职业技能、实时监测状态并回血回蓝、按规则过滤拾取道具、自动执行日常基础任务。脚本编写多基于按键精灵、触动精灵等手游脚本工具,核心依赖坐标定位、图像识别、状态监测三大基础元素。
二、脚本核心逻辑框架
整体逻辑闭环:脚本启动初始化参数→校验玩家状态(存活、地图位置)→图像识别锁定目标怪物→模拟触屏执行攻击/释放技能→实时监测血量魔法值并补给→怪物死亡后执行拾取→自动移动至下一个刷新点→重复流程;若触发任务条件则跳转任务执行模块。核心依赖变量:目标怪物图像模板、技能释放坐标、回血回蓝阈值、拾取道具图像列表。
三、分模块脚本编写(适配龙腾火龙手游)
1. 脚本初始化与工具选择(基础前置)
优先选用按键精灵手机版(支持安卓/iOS),需提前开启手机无障碍权限与脚本悬浮窗权限。初始化核心参数时,需明确目标对象与操作阈值:选用变量1(obj_monster)存储火龙卫士图像模板,变量2(pos_skill1)记录烈火剑法释放坐标(适配战士职业),变量3(hp_threshold)设定回血阈值(如30%),变量4(pick_list)存储需拾取道具图像(金砖、火龙碎片、强效药水)。
// 龙腾火龙手游脚本初始化(按键精灵语法)
Dim obj_monster, pos_skill1, hp_threshold, pick_list
// 加载目标怪物图像模板(火龙卫士,提前截取游戏内图像保存)
obj_monster = 图像加载("火龙卫士.png")
// 设定技能释放坐标(按手机屏幕分辨率校准,示例为1080P分辨率)
pos_skill1 = Array(800, 900)
// 设定回血回蓝阈值
hp_threshold = 30 // 血量低于30%自动回血
mp_threshold = 20 // 魔法值低于20%自动回蓝
// 设定需拾取道具图像列表
pick_list = Array("金砖.png", "火龙碎片.png", "强效金疮药.png")
// 启动脚本提示
弹窗("龙腾火龙自动脚本已启动,目标:火龙卫士")
// 跳转至状态校验流程
Goto 状态校验
2. 状态校验与异常处理(关键前置)
脚本执行前需校验玩家核心状态,避免异常操作导致失效。重点监测玩家存活状态、当前地图位置、背包剩余空格三大核心维度,任一维度异常则暂停脚本并提示。
// 状态校验模块
状态校验:
// 识别玩家存活状态(通过游戏内血条是否存在判断)
If 图像查找(区域(100,20,200,120), "血条模板.png") = -1 Then
弹窗("玩家已死亡,脚本暂停")
脚本停止
End If
// 识别当前地图(通过地图标识图像判断是否在火龙神殿)
If 图像查找(区域(900,20,1000,80), "火龙神殿标识.png") = -1 Then
弹窗("当前不在目标地图,脚本暂停")
脚本停止
End If
// 监测背包空格(通过背包空格标识数量判断)
Dim empty_slot
empty_slot = 图像计数(区域(300,600,700,900), "背包空格.png")
If empty_slot < 3 Then
弹窗("背包空格不足3个,建议清理")
// 可选:自动执行背包清理(删除指定垃圾道具)
Goto 背包清理
End If
// 状态校验通过,跳转至怪物锁定模块
Goto 怪物锁定
3. 目标锁定与自动移动(核心关键)
龙腾火龙手游怪物刷新点相对固定(如火龙神殿一层左上方、三层中心区域),脚本采用“图像识别+坐标移动”组合方式锁定目标。通过提前截取的怪物图像模板,在指定区域内查找目标,找到则模拟触屏移动至攻击范围,未找到则按预设路线循环寻怪。
// 怪物锁定与自动移动模块
怪物锁定:
// 在指定区域(火龙神殿常用打怪区域)查找目标怪物
Dim monster_x, monster_y
monster_x, monster_y = 图像查找(区域(200,200,800,800), obj_monster)
If monster_x <> -1 Then
// 找到怪物,模拟触屏移动至攻击范围(距离怪物坐标50像素内)
触屏滑动(当前坐标X, 当前坐标Y, monster_x-50, monster_y-50, 500) // 500毫秒完成移动
延迟(1000) // 预留移动缓冲时间
Goto 自动攻击
Else
// 未找到怪物,按预设路线循环寻怪
弹窗("未找到目标怪物,自动寻怪中")
预设寻怪路线()
Goto 怪物锁定
End If
// 预设寻怪路线(火龙神殿一层示例)
Sub 预设寻怪路线()
// 按顺序移动至三个核心刷新点
触屏滑动(当前坐标X, 当前坐标Y, 300, 300, 800)
延迟(1500)
触屏滑动(当前坐标X, 当前坐标Y, 500, 600, 800)
延迟(1500)
触屏滑动(当前坐标X, 当前坐标Y, 700, 400, 800)
延迟(1500)
End Sub
4. 自动攻击与技能释放(核心功能)
适配龙腾火龙三大职业核心技能:战士优先烈火剑法、法师优先冰咆哮、道士优先灵魂火符+召唤神兽。脚本需设置技能冷却时间,避免空放;同时实时监测怪物状态,确保攻击有效性。
// 自动攻击与技能释放模块(以战士为例)
自动攻击:
// 确认怪物仍在攻击范围内
Dim m_x, m_y
m_x, m_y = 图像查找(区域(200,200,800,800), obj_monster)
If m_x = -1 Then
Goto 怪物锁定
End If
// 模拟普通攻击(点击怪物坐标)
触屏点击(m_x, m_y, 1) // 点击1次
// 技能释放逻辑(判断冷却时间)
Static skill_cd
If skill_cd = 0 Then
// 释放烈火剑法(点击预设技能坐标)
触屏点击(pos_skill1(0), pos_skill1(1), 1)
弹窗("释放技能:烈火剑法")
skill_cd = 5 // 设定5秒冷却时间
Else
skill_cd = skill_cd - 1
End If
// 监测怪物是否死亡(血条消失判断)
If 图像查找(区域(m_x-50, m_y-50, m_x+50, m_y+50), "怪物血条.png") = -1 Then
延迟(1000) // 预留怪物死亡动画时间
Goto 自动拾取
End If
// 实时监测自身血量,低于阈值自动回血
Dim hp_current
hp_current = 图像识别百分比(区域(100,20,200,120), "血量模板.png") // 识别血量百分比
If hp_current <= hp_threshold Then
// 点击背包内强效金疮药坐标
触屏点击(400, 700, 1)
弹窗("血量不足,自动回血")
延迟(500)
End If
// 延迟1秒后重复攻击流程
延迟(1000)
Goto 自动攻击
5. 自动拾取与道具过滤(贴合版本特性)
龙腾火龙核心拾取道具为金砖、火龙碎片、强效药水、火龙系列装备,脚本需通过图像识别过滤垃圾道具,仅拾取预设列表内的物品,避免占用背包空间。
// 自动拾取模块
自动拾取:
// 遍历拾取道具列表,查找周围可拾取物品
For Each item In pick_list
Dim item_x, item_y
item_x, item_y = 图像查找(区域(100,100,900,900), item)
If item_x <> -1 Then
// 移动至道具位置并拾取
触屏滑动(当前坐标X, 当前坐标Y, item_x, item_y, 500)
延迟(500)
触屏点击(item_x, item_y, 1) // 点击拾取
弹窗("已拾取:" & item)
延迟(500)
End If
Next
// 拾取完成后跳转至寻怪流程
Goto 怪物锁定
// 背包清理模块(删除垃圾道具)
背包清理:
// 识别并删除指定垃圾道具(如破旧布衣)
Dim trash_x, trash_y
trash_x, trash_y = 图像查找(区域(300,600,700,900), "破旧布衣.png")
If trash_x <> -1 Then
// 长按垃圾道具触发删除选项
触屏长按(trash_x, trash_y, 1000) // 长按1秒
延迟(500)
// 点击删除按钮坐标
触屏点击(600, 300, 1)
弹窗("已清理垃圾道具")
End If
// 清理后重新校验背包空格
Goto 状态校验
四、龙腾火龙手游脚本专属适配注意事项
1. 工具权限设置:安卓手机需开启“悬浮窗权限”“无障碍权限”,部分机型需关闭纯净模式;iOS手机需通过信任证书授权脚本工具,确保脚本正常运行。
2. 坐标与图像校准:不同手机分辨率(720P、1080P、2K)需单独校准技能、道具、药水的坐标位置;游戏内画质设置为“标准”,避免画质差异导致图像识别失败。
3. 操作频率控制:触屏点击与滑动延迟建议设置为500-1000毫秒,过短可能被判定为异常操作,需结合游戏内操作节奏调整。
4. 图像模板更新:游戏更新后若怪物、道具、地图标识图像发生变化,需重新截取图像模板并替换脚本内对应文件,否则脚本会失效。
五、脚本调试与常见问题解决
1. 脚本无法启动:检查手机权限是否开启完整,脚本工具是否为最新版本,游戏是否处于后台运行状态(需前台运行)。
2. 怪物锁定失败:核对怪物图像模板是否清晰,查找区域是否覆盖游戏内打怪范围,调整图像识别相似度(建议设置为80%)。
3. 技能不释放:校验技能坐标是否准确,技能冷却时间设置是否合理,部分职业技能需前置条件(如战士烈火剑法需蓄力),需在脚本内添加对应逻辑。
4. 拾取无效:确认道具图像模板与游戏内一致,背包是否有足够空格,拾取时是否有其他道具遮挡目标物品。
上述脚本完全适配龙腾火龙传奇手游特性,替换图像模板与坐标参数后即可直接使用。核心是通过图像识别与触屏模拟适配手游操作逻辑,兼顾打怪效率与流程稳定性,新手可按模块逐步调试,快速实现自动化游戏操作。

